# Copyright (c) Twisted Matrix Laboratories.
# See LICENSE for details.
"""Creation of Windows shortcuts.
Requires win32all.
"""
from win32com.shell import shell
import pythoncom
import os
def open(filename):
"""Open an existing shortcut for reading.
@return: The shortcut object
@rtype: Shortcut
"""
sc=Shortcut()
sc.load(filename)
return sc
class Shortcut:
"""A shortcut on Win32.
>>> sc=Shortcut(path, arguments, description, workingdir, iconpath, iconidx)
@param path: Location of the target
@param arguments: If path points to an executable, optional arguments to
pass
@param description: Human-readable decription of target
@param workingdir: Directory from which target is launched
@param iconpath: Filename that contains an icon for the shortcut
@param iconidx: If iconpath is set, optional index of the icon desired
"""
def __init__(self,
path=None,
arguments=None,
description=None,
workingdir=None,
iconpath=None,
iconidx=0):
self._base = pythoncom.CoCreateInstance(
shell.CLSID_ShellLink, None,
pythoncom.CLSCTX_INPROC_SERVER, shell.IID_IShellLink
)
data = map(None,
['"%s"' % os.path.abspath(path), arguments, description,
os.path.abspath(workingdir), os.path.abspath(iconpath)],
("SetPath", "SetArguments", "SetDescription",
"SetWorkingDirectory") )
for value, function in data:
if value and function:
# call function on each non-null value
getattr(self, function)(value)
if iconpath:
self.SetIconLocation(iconpath, iconidx)
def load( self, filename ):
"""Read a shortcut file from disk."""
self._base.QueryInterface(pythoncom.IID_IPersistFile).Load(filename)
def save( self, filename ):
"""Write the shortcut to disk.
The file should be named something.lnk.
"""
self._base.QueryInterface(pythoncom.IID_IPersistFile).Save(filename, 0)
def __getattr__( self, name ):
if name != "_base":
return getattr(self._base, name)
raise AttributeError, "%s instance has no attribute %s" % \
(self.__class__.__name__, name)
